Overview

The Illinois Fighting Illini men's basketball program is widely anticipated to secure the top spot in preseason national rankings for the upcoming 2026-2027 season. This projection follows their impressive run to the 2026 NCAA Tournament Final Four, a significant achievement marking their deepest tournament advancement since 2005. The team's strong performance culminated in a close loss to the eventual national champions, the UConn Huskies, in a highly competitive semifinal matchup.

The primary driver behind Illinois's elevated preseason expectations is the successful retention of its core roster. Several key players who were instrumental in their 2026 Final Four campaign have opted to return, bypassing opportunities to declare for the NBA Draft or transfer to other programs. This continuity is expected to provide a solid foundation for the team as they aim to build upon last season's success and contend for a national championship.

Background & Context

Illinois's journey to the 2026 Final Four represented a significant resurgence for the program, which had experienced a period of relative inconsistency in deep tournament runs. Their 2005 appearance, where they ultimately lost in the championship game, had long been a benchmark for the program's aspirations. The 2026 team's ability to navigate the challenging NCAA tournament bracket and reach the sport's pinnacle event underscored the effectiveness of their coaching staff and the talent development within the program.

Historically, teams that achieve deep tournament runs and subsequently retain key talent often see a significant boost in preseason polls. This trend reflects the perceived advantage of experience, established team chemistry, and proven performance under pressure. For Illinois, this trajectory positions them as a leading contender, drawing parallels to other programs that have successfully parlayed Final Four appearances into dominant subsequent seasons.
